Follow Up to "Critical" Violations Noted on Previous Inspections (if applicable)
Code 302 noted on Routine inspection # ADIG-D3KM7C of Mar-21-2024
Equipment/utensils/food contact surfaces not properly washed and sanitized [s. 17(2)]
Observation: Dishwasher has a strong sulphur smell at beginning of run.
Dish water at end of cycle does not appear to have much soap suds.
No chlorine at end of final rinse cycle - 0ppm measured.
Operator says dishwasher not working has been on-going issue and has consulted with contractor.
Correction: Use regular bleach available for sanitizing using the 3 compartment sink method OR use single use dishes.
Test strips are available in the facility - ensure sanitizer measures 100ppm for sanitizing dishes.
Call your dishwasher contractor: ensure dishwasher is fixed as soon as possible.
Ensure to do regular water testing for your well as per your Drinking Water Officer.
Date to be completed by: Immediately.
Comments

Follow up after contractor visit:

-Chlorine tests between 50-100ppm both in the tank water and at the plate surface.
-Some soap suds appear in the tank.

No further issues to follow up on at this time. Thank you.
